Citations
3 citations on file for this inspection.
1926.451 B01
- Issued
- Feb 23, 2015
- Penalty
- Initial $1,800 · Current $900 Reduced
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.451(b)(1): Each platform on all working levels of scaffolding was not fully planked or decked: (a). Worksite located at 3210 S. Lee's Summit Road, Independence, Missouri- Employees were exposed to a fall or striking hazard in that the work levels not full planked or decked.

1926.451 F15
- Issued
- Feb 23, 2015
- Penalty
- Initial $1,800 · Current $900 Reduced
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.451(f)(15): Ladders were used on scaffolds to increase the working level height of employees: without satisfying the criteria of subparagraphs (i) - (iv) of this paragraph: (a). Worksite located at 3210 S. Lee's Summit Road, Independence, Missouri- Employee was exposed to a fall or collapse hazard in that a step-ladder was being used on a scaffold that was not designed to have a ladder on top of the structure.

1926.451 G01
- Issued
- Feb 23, 2015
- Penalty
- Initial $2,520 · Current $1,260 Reduced
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.451(g)(1): Each employee on a scaffold more than 10 feet above a lower level were not protected from falling to that lower level: (a). Worksite located at 3210 S. Lee's Summit Road, Lee's Summit, Missouri- Employees were observed working and walking on scaffolding and climbing from one section of scaffolding to another without the use of fall protection.
